Compression socks

Dressing:

  • Always dress the product by "rolling" (not pulling) and carefully arrange it.
  • Always wear a compression product against the skin, so do not leave, for example, a leg or similar product.
  • Removing the product should also be done by rolling.

Compression sleeves

Dressing:

  • Always dress and remove the sleeves instead of pulling.
  • Dress up the sleeves enough so that the upper reservoir of the sleeves comes close to the armpit.
  • Always wear the compression product against the skin, so do not leave, for example, the sleeve of the shirt or the like.
  • The reinforced cellular zone of the sleeves comes to the outside of the elbow.

Starting use:

  • Usually getting used to compression pressure takes 1-3 training sessions, so do not start using a compression product eg at a competition event

Recommended use:

  • Used during performance, use can be started for 30-45 min. prior to performance

Aptitude:

  • Ideal for almost any kind of training and sport
